PERIMENOPAUSE

Perimenopause is a period of transition leading up to menopause. It typically begins when a woman is in her late 30s to mid-40s and can last several years. During this time oestrogen and progesterone levels fluctuate, which can present as a range of symptoms. These include but are not limited to: joint pain, weight gain, vaginal dryness, bladder control issues, brain fog, mood swings, sleep disturbances, increased blood pressure and susceptibility to chronic inflammation and autoimmune issues. In fact, there are at least 34 recognised symptoms of perimenopause and menopause and some experts identify up to 50.

MENOPAUSE

Menopause marks the end of perimenopause, when a woman has not had a menstrual period for 12 consecutive months. There are a range of menopause-related musculoskeletal conditions, which are linked to hormonal changes, decreased collagen production, and increased inflammation. These include but are not limited to: frozen shoulder, gluteal tendinopathy, osteoarthritis, plantar fasciopathy, carpal tunnel syndrome, muscle loss and osteoporosis. The symptoms of these vary but include increasing stiffness and pain in various parts of your body, fluid retention, changes in your soft and connective tissues, loss of bone density and increased risk of fractures, especially in the spine, hips and wrists.

Additionally, research shows that strength training and aerobic exercise are essential for hormonal balance, bone density and metabolism during perimenopause and menopause. Our compassionate exercise physiologist Kate designs individualised programs to: build muscle mass and prevent osteoporosis; boost energy levels and manage fatigue; improve cardiovascular health and metabolism; reduce stress and cortisol levels. Strength training 2-3 times per week helps to preserve muscle mass and stimulate bone growth.
